The RemoteIoT platform SSH simplifies the process of remotely accessing and managing your Raspberry Pi devices. By using SSH (Secure Shell), you can remotely access your Raspberry Pi, transfer files, execute commands, and even send batch jobs directly from a web portal. Furthermore, the platform eliminates the need to discover the IoT device's IP address or modify firewall settings, streamlining the entire process and saving you time and effort. The following table presents a comparative analysis of the key features offered by RemoteIoT Platform SSH and other similar solutions available in the market.
Feature | RemoteIoT Platform SSH | Alternative Solutions (e.g., TeamViewer, VNC) |
---|---|---|
Remote Access Type | SSH (Secure Shell) | GUI-based, Remote Desktop |
Security | High (Encrypted SSH tunnels) | Variable (Dependent on the specific implementation) |
Ease of Setup | Simple, requires minimal configuration | Can be complex, may require port forwarding |
Firewall Compatibility | Excellent, works behind NAT routers and firewalls | Can be problematic without proper configuration |
Resource Usage | Low, efficient for embedded devices | Higher, may impact device performance |
Cost | Freemium (Free for basic use) | Variable (Subscription-based for some) |
Command Execution | Direct command execution via terminal | Indirect, often requires GUI interaction |
File Transfer | Secure file transfer using SSH | Varies, often dependent on the chosen method |
Web Portal Integration | Yes, for command execution and batch jobs | No, typically requires separate software |
